用Java构建数字校园管理系统
大家好,今天我们来聊聊怎么用Java来构建一个数字校园管理系统。首先,我们要明确的是,数字校园是指利用信息技术手段对学校教学、科研、管理和服务等进行数字化改造的系统。
我们今天的目标是做一个简化版的管理系统,主要功能包括用户登录、信息查询和数据管理。为了实现这些功能,我们需要用到Java的一些基础库,比如JDBC来进行数据库操作。
接下来,我们先来看看数据库的设计。假设我们有一个用户表(users),它包含字段如id(主键)、username(用户名)和password(密码)。下面是一个创建这个表的SQL语句: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50) NOT NULL,
password VARCHAR(50) NOT NULL
);
然后,我们需要编写Java代码来连接这个数据库并执行一些基本的操作。这里是一个简单的Java类,用于连接数据库并插入一条新用户记录:
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
public class UserManagement {
public static void main(String[] args) {
String url = "jdbc:mysql://localhost:3306/digital_campus";
String user = "root";
String password = "your_password";
try {
Connection conn = DriverManager.getConnection(url, user, password);
String sql = "INSERT INTO users (username, password) VALUES (?, ?)";
PreparedStatement pstmt = conn.prepareStatement(sql);
pstmt.setString(1, "testUser");
pstmt.setString(2, "testPass");
int rowsInserted = pstmt.executeUpdate();
if (rowsInserted > 0) {
System.out.println("A new user was inserted successfully!");
}
} catch (Exception e) {
e.printStackTrace();
}
}
}
以上就是我们今天的内容啦!通过这个简单的例子,大家可以了解到如何开始用Java来构建自己的数字校园管理系统。希望这能激发你们的兴趣,继续探索更多有趣的编程项目!
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!